Inspiration for Aisha Powell
John drew his inspiration for Aisha from his family. “In my life, I grew up surrounded by black women.” He explained that “until the last few years I haven’t seen black women represented in positive ways. The hyperfocused overachieving black girl nerd was something fun I wanted to explore.”
Aisha became her own hero with FightSong!
Aisha always self-identified as an “overachieving nerd” but it wasn’t until high school that the pressure she’d put on herself academically really started to impact her. She began to get really bad anxiety during things she used to enjoy, like timed essay prompts. During an AP US History test (not the final, just a normal test) her anxiety got so bad that it became a full blown anxiety attack. At that moment she knew that she needed help and she decided to DM her school counselor using FightSong to get support and context for what was happening to her.
Her counselor messaged back and offered Aisha an in-office visit, which she declined– (too busy, had to study), but was able to provide Aisha a place to just talk and safely communicate her stress in a way she just couldn’t anywhere else. Her counselor also provided her some links on how to best manage academic stress and connected her with study groups so she could multitask– socialize and study.
